Hi all - I would expect this to export only the three fields specified in the output file, but it is giving me the entire dictionary. How can I export only the specified fields?

TIA,

Mike O.

* declare function inet_oi_xml request=' cmd=LIST tablename field1 field2 field3 dosfile=c:\xml\tester' select_statement=' template_name=' schema_file=' retval=inet_oi_xml(request,cmd,dosfile,select_statement,schema_file,template_name) **


At 19 AUG 2008 09:39AM Bob Carten wrote:

Hi Mike,

I tried your code, I got the correct answer.

I'll look into it.


At 19 AUG 2008 05:41PM Bob Carten wrote:

Problem solved - Was caused by an application-specific copy of INET_RLIST_PARSE introduced by a consultant whose initials are "rjc"
